Reddit Inc. (NYSE:RDDT) shares climbed after the company released its third-quarter earnings report after Thursday's closing bell, beating estimates on the top and bottom lines.
The Details: Reddit reported quarterly earnings of 80 cents per share, which beat the analyst estimate of 52 cents by 55%.
Quarterly revenue came in at $585 million, which beat the analyst consensus estimate of $545.71 million by 7.2%.

Reddit reported the following third quarter highlights:
“Reddit provides something rare on the Internet,” said Steve Huffman, Reddit CEO.
“444 million people come here each week for authentic conversations they can’t find anywhere else, and increasingly, for engagement with brands, institutions and publishers,” Huffman added.
Outlook: Reddit sees fourth-quarter revenue in a range of $655 million to $665 million, versus the $637.88 million analyst estimate.
RDDT Stock Price: According to data from Benzinga Pro, Reddit stock was up 5.20% at $204.53 in Thursday's extended trading.
